Копирование файлов из моего / дома в загрузочную оболочку для спасения на VirtualBox [dубликат]

У этого вопроса уже есть ответ здесь: Как сбросить потерянный административный пароль? 13 ответов Восстановление учетной записи пользователя на виртуальной машине (после попытки расширения памяти) 1 ответ Восстановление файлов пользователя с помощью Live CD 2 ответов

У меня есть Mac с Ubuntu 14.04, установленным в VirtualBox.

Во время обновления я потерял окно входа в систему. Кто-то предложил мне удалить и повторно установить гостевые дополнения, но это звучит как слишком много хлопот. Я просто хочу войти в систему и перенести файлы, которые я хочу в свою общую папку, а затем удалить все это и начать все заново.

Когда я удерживаю кнопку shift, я получаю меню GRUB, и я могу выбрать режим восстановления. Теперь я в оболочке «root @ virtualbox», но я никуда не могу. Команда

ls ничего не делает. Я даже не знаю, где я.

Как найти домашнюю папку моего пользователя и переместить файлы?

Я также попытался установить образ vdi, но не работал:

http://bluepilltech.blogspot.com/2010/03/how-to-mount-virtualbox-vdi-image-under.html https://unfinishedbitness.info/2017/02/06/ mac-os-x-native-vdi-image-mounts /

Установка нового ubuntu в VBox отлично поработала. Спасибо! Я могу смотреть на старый vdi просто отлично, но домашняя папка все еще зашифрована. Поэтому мне интересно, если я изменил пароль root в зашифрованном компьютере, будет ли он использовать вновь созданный pw для шифрования, и поэтому я снова смогу увидеть содержимое домашней папки?

1
задан 1 December 2017 в 10:04

2 ответа

Когда вы дойдете до подсказки, выполните:

cd /home ls

что вы видите? Также:

lsblk

и

fdisk -l

Это должно дать вам аналогичные списки доступных блочных устройств и их разделов. Любой из этих разделов выглядит как ваш / домашний раздел?

Те, которые интересны, перечислены как «Тип Linux» или аналогичные в списке fdisk. F.ex., предположим, что существует / dev / sda1. Теперь вы можете монтировать этот раздел где-то:

mkdir test_dir mount /dev/sda1 test_dir ls test_dir

не забудьте отключить test_dir после того, как вы спасли все, что вам нужно, чтобы спасти:

umount test_dir
1
ответ дан 18 July 2018 в 02:24

Когда вы дойдете до подсказки, выполните:

cd /home ls

что вы видите? Также:

lsblk

и

fdisk -l

Это должно дать вам аналогичные списки доступных блочных устройств и их разделов. Любой из этих разделов выглядит как ваш / домашний раздел?

Те, которые интересны, перечислены как «Тип Linux» или аналогичные в списке fdisk. F.ex., предположим, что существует / dev / sda1. Теперь вы можете монтировать этот раздел где-то:

mkdir test_dir mount /dev/sda1 test_dir ls test_dir

не забудьте отключить test_dir после того, как вы спасли все, что вам нужно, чтобы спасти:

umount test_dir
1
ответ дан 24 July 2018 в 17:33
  • 1
    Спасибо! Я нашел свою домашнюю папку, но когда я зашел внутрь и сделаю & quot; ls & quot; Я получаю: access-your-private-data.desktop README.txt – prism 29 November 2017 в 00:59
  • 2
    Что вы ожидали в своей папке /home? Возможно, он зашифрован? Что находится в README.txt? [F3] – Tomáš Pospíšek 29 November 2017 в 01:05
  • 3
    да, похоже. Внутри файла говорится: «Этот каталог был размонтирован для защиты ваших данных. FROm запуска командной строки: ecryptfs-mount-private, и я получаю: ERROR: зашифрованный закрытый каталог не настроен должным образом – prism 29 November 2017 в 01:10
  • 4
    Итак, вот задача Google: как дешифровать этот каталог вручную :-) – Tomáš Pospíšek 29 November 2017 в 01:15
  • 5
    «encrypt-unwrap-passphrase home» спрашивает у меня парольную фразу, которую я не помню ... Я предполагаю, что я пытаюсь установить с помощью live cd .. – prism 29 November 2017 в 22:49

Другие вопросы по тегам:

Похожие вопросы: